About E. J Wallis
E. J Wallis is a scholar working on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Economics and Econometrics, Complementary and alternative medicine and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, having authored 6 papers that have together received 344 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(3 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(2 papers),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(2 papers), Phytochemistry Medicinal Plant Applications (1 paper), Acupuncture Treatment Research Studies (1 paper), Antiplatelet Therapy and Cardiovascular Diseases (1 paper), Complementary and Alternative Medicine Studies (1 paper) and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(75 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(86 citations), Surgery (78 citations), Geriatrics and Gerontology (6 citations) and Complementary and alternative medicine (11 citations). E. J Wallis has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om and Germany. Frequent co-authors include W W Yeo, L E Ramsay, Peter Jackson, Iftikhar Ul Haq, I. Gerhard, LE Ramsay and PR Jackson.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, Homeopathy, Heart, BMJ and Heart.
